Strike by CNG dealers in CNG hits commuters

KARACHI, June 6: Many people had to travel on the rooftop of buses on Wednesday to reach their destinations as public transport remained thin on city roads due to an indefinite strike called by a CNG dealers association.

While the few rickshaws and taxis available during the day raised fares, motorists, too, had to spend much more on petrol and diesel due to the closure of gas stations, which also hit ambulance services.
